MAPUSA: In the Guirim hit and run case, the Mapusa Police have added section 304, 201 of IPC i.e. Culpable homicide not amounting to murder and destruction of evidence to the crime against accused Milind Naik Dessai.
Mapuca Police during the investigation of death of Pradeep Narvekar R/o Guirim, Bardez, Goa received blood report of Alcohol test of Accused driver Milind Dessai.
SDPO Mapuca Jivba Dalvi informed that the action was taken based on alcohol estimation report which is received from the Department of Pathology, District hospital, Mapusa which has come positive towards Consumption of alcohol by accused driver Milind Naik Dessai.
Mapuca police were investigating hit and run case at NH-66 road , Guirim, Bardez, Goa which had occurred on 15.10.2023.
Police have written to the Court regarding addition of Sections 304, 201 IPC
Police further wrote to court that the accused Milind Naik Dessai is Advocate by profession and he has knowledge of his act.
